Decorations here go up around 21st to 23rd December, it was 23rd this year. All stay up until twelfth night on 5th January when everything barring the crib is taken down just before bed. That is the end of Christmas and Epiphany begins on 6th when the three kings are put into the crib, which stays up until Candlemas.
